The Honorary Consulate for the Midlands hosted a reception for members of the Midlands interfaith community ahead of their upcoming visit to Bosnia and Herzegovina this June.
During their visit to the Consulate in Birmingham, the delegation met with Dr. Anes Cerić, Honorary Consul, to discuss the programme, including a planned visit to the Potočari Memorial Centre, and to gain a deeper understanding of the historical and social context they will encounter.
The meeting provided an important opportunity for dialogue, reflection and preparation for the upcoming visit.
The Honorary Consulate of Bosnia and Herzegovina for the Midlands opened last year and is now fully operational, based in the Bosnian House in Birmingham.
The Consulate’s mission is to build bridges and strengthen ties between the UK and Bosnia and Herzegovina through the development of economic, cultural and sporting cooperation, as well as fostering mutual understanding and partnership between communities.
